Live Performance of Sabbath Bloody Sabbath by Black Sabbath (1998)
In the live recording of "Sabbath Bloody Sabbath" from December 31, 1998, Black Sabbath was riding a significant wave of resurgence with their Reunion Tour. This period marked their return to the stage after a break, and fans were thrilled to see the original lineup back together. Before this live show, the band had released the album "Forbidden" in 1995, a project that had mixed reviews but featured guest appearances from notable musicians, showcasing their willingness to evolve. During the 1998 show at Bank One Ballpark in Phoenix, Ozzy Osbourne performed with raw energy, delivering a powerful rendition of the classic track, demonstrating how their music had stood the test of time, resonating deeply with fans. It's fascinating to think about how much history was packed into that performance, as Black Sabbath was not just celebrating a new beginning but also honoring decades of rock legacy.
